Lots of things don't make sense about this story. A lot can be blamed on poor reporting, but as a former LEO, welfare checks, even where bodily harm is claimed, never meant that a "team" of officers, surrounding a dark house in the wee hours of the morning.

If they had truly knocked on the door, or rang the bell, someone would have moved that direction, to at least find out who was there. But if they were creeping around outside making unidentifiable noises, near windows, the natural response from a homeowner, would be to arm himself, and possibly point a gun in the direction of the noise.

There will need to be a lot if questions answered, regarding this entire incident, starting with the original call, and the response, by law enforcement.

here's a problem about punishing the swatter's.....apparently many of them, since many, many are gamers, are out of country, many in Russia, they can't be held accountable, can't even be proven who they are even though often the kids know "gamer x" did it, there isn't anyway to prove who "gamer x" is when they are overseas. Until we can get other governments to help, there's nothing to be done.
